How much do internship hiking guide j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 2, 2026, the average hourly pay for internship hiking guide in the United States is $16.65,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.42 and $18.51 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Internship Hiking Guide vs Entry-Level Outdoor Guide?

AspectInternship Hiking GuideEntry-Level Outdoor Guide
CredentialsBasic outdoor certifications, first aidSimilar certifications, sometimes more experience required
Work EnvironmentGuided hikes, outdoor settings, seasonalOutdoor adventure settings, may include different activities
Employer & IndustryTour companies, outdoor recreationOutdoor adventure companies, parks, resorts

Internship Hiking Guides typically have basic outdoor certifications and gain hands-on experience during seasonal guided hikes. Entry-Level Outdoor Guides may have similar credentials but often require some prior experience. Both roles operate in outdoor environments within the outdoor recreation industry, serving tourists and adventure seekers. The internship serves as a training period, while entry-level guides are more independently responsible for guiding groups.

Job description

This internship offers the opportunity to help conduct field research in Reykjavik Iceland with one of our research teams. This expedition will focus on developing two publications:

  • Develop the first hiking trails magazine with short stories capturing the culture and environment of Iceland.
  • A naturalist guide and cultural guide website/web-app to Reykjavik and south Iceland.

The ultimate goal of the publications is to provide travelers with insight into the culture and environment they will be traveling through. Information we will be capturing will include Icelandic culture, history, geography, geology, wildlife, natural resources, economy, health care, religion, tourism impacts and more.

Interns will complete pre-trip investigative research, conduct action research for 1 week in Iceland, and spend 2 months wrapping up their research from their home or university during the summer or fall semester.
